If a spherical body is symmetrical about its perpendicular axes, the moment of inertia of the body about an axis passing through its centre of gravity as given by Routh's rule is obtained by dividing the product of the mass and the sum of the squares of two semi-axes by n where n is

According to Ruth Rule of Moment of Inertia;
For Spherical Body, n = 5.
Circle/Rectangle Lamina, n = 4.
Square/Rectangle Body, n = 3.
